THE CITYโS flagship museum will close for 11 days next month to allow essential maintenance works to take place, before plans for a major refurbishment get under way.
Leicester Museum & Art Gallery on New Walk will be closed to the public from Thursday 5 September until Sunday 15 September inclusive, while new fire curtains are installed and other maintenance works carried out.
The museum will reopen on Monday 16 September, but access will be limited to the Dinosaur Gallery and the Leicester Stories Gallery until Saturday 21 September, while new temporary exhibitions are installed on the first floor.
These initial works will pave the way for the start of a major refurbishment that โ subject to planning permission โ will create a new suite of art galleries on the museumโs ground floor, as well as a new shop, an improved reception area and a new cafรฉ with an entrance from New Walk.
The ground floor art galleries โ including the Victorian Art Gallery and galleries currently hosting the Attenborough Collection of Picasso Ceramics and National Treasures: Renoir in Leicester โ will close to the public at 5pm on Sunday 1 September. Museum staff will then begin the huge task of carefully emptying the galleries and putting the collections safely into storage, before contractors move in to start the planned refurbishment.

Subject to planning permission, the new cafรฉ space will be created at the front of the museum, with a new entrance from New Walk that will allow the cafรฉ to stay open when the rest of the museum is closed.
An original glass roof and feature columns, currently hidden within exhibition space, will be revealed in the new scheme, creating a light and airy space for cafรฉ customers to enjoy.
Two planning applications, covering the proposed works and the required listed building consent, are expected to be determined in September.
The revamped art galleries are due to open to the public in late 2025.
Leicester Museum & Art Gallery opened in 1849 as one of the UKโs first public museums and today attracts more than 250,000 visitors each year โ making it one of the most popular free attractions in the East Midlands.
Reconfiguring the layout and upgrading the gallery spaces will help it reach a new target of 300,000 visitors each year.
The ยฃ7.9m refurbishment of Leicester Museum & Art Gallery is supported by ยฃ766,000 from Arts Council Englandโs Museum Estate and Development Fund.
